## Inventory Write-Down — Q3 (Managers Only)

Quick heads-up for the board: we're taking a write-down on the Brightline fixture stock sitting in the Calder Bay warehouse. Roughly 18% of units failed the updated moisture spec, and reworking them costs more than they're worth. Merla's team flagged it early, so no surprises in the audited numbers. We'll fold the adjustment into the Q3 close and tighten incoming inspection at Calder Bay. The knock-on effect for next year's plan is below.

management briefing: The renewal with Zoraelax Group closes at $10 million a year, 15 percent below the last contract. Project Ralael slips by six weeks because of the audit delay.

## Env vars: health checks behind the Norwick LB

Hey, welcome aboard! The Norwick load balancer pings `/healthz` on every Quillport node, and the handler checks `HEALTH_PORT` and `HEALTH_TIMEOUT_MS` from the env file. If either is missing, the node gets pulled from rotation — yes, really. The health endpoint also requires a shared token so randos can't probe it. Put that token on the next line of `.env`:

vault entry, bafog-taweg: COURIER_KEY13=4c7e8222ea2ea

First-day checklist — night shift, Dovehill site

- Collect lanyard from the security hutch.
- Walk the new starter past the interview suite (Room N2). Secure room; door stays locked at all times.
- No guests inside without a supervisor present.
- Log every entry in the red book.
- To unlock N2 for scheduled interviews, key in the code below.

badge for fafop-fajof: bdg-Z-47